review this deal for me

10 team, 4 keeper league, NO PPR,

10 rush yds = 1 pt
10 rec yds = 1 pt
All TD's = 6 pts

Full Trade:

I receive: DeShaun Foster, Kevin Curtis, Chris Henry (Cin)

I give up: Reggie Bush (and had to drop Tatum Bell, who he picked up)

my new roster:

Brady
Roethlisberger

Henry
Foster
J. Jones

Colston
Evans
Curtis
C. Johnson (Detroit)
Welker
McDonald
Colbert
Hackett

Gates
Miller

I did this deal because a) Foster's outperforming Bush in the short term, and while Deuce is going to be out, Bush is still going to be used as he was before, not as the feature back, and in a non-PPR league, that's spelled a rocky start with no end in sight, and b) I don't think Evans is going to rebound anytime soon, and I also don't think that last week was an aberration with Curtis, while he put up mammoth stats, I think that McNabb's going to continue to target Curtis throughout the season, as he's proving himself to be a reliable target........

so what do the outlaw's think?

Ya, I don't really think I like this deal in a keeper league. You seem to already have questionable depth at RB (more so than WR) and who knows how Deangello will develop this year. Foster might not be anything next year. And Bush will end the year with at least equal stats from last year. You already have so much youth in your WR's, and really ,what does Chris Henry do for you. He might play a few games this year, but it's not like he'll be one of your 4 keepers
